局域网445端口不通,共享文件服务无法正常使用

  Windows Server在使用SQL Server数据库做主从同步时需要使用共享文件夹用于数据库之间的仲裁见证,这就要求需要配置主从同步的两台Windows Server共享文件(SMB服务)服务必须可用,共享文件服务的主要使用端口为445,由于此端口易受攻击所以很可能系统内部已经禁用了此端口,如果该端口不通,请使用如下方法解决:

解决方案

  • 确保网卡属性中的Microsoft网络的文件和打印机共享服务处于开启状态。

  • 确保防火墙已经开放了文件共享服务的入站规则,或者关闭防火墙。

  • 确保组策略中IP安全策略没有对IP进行限制。

如果组策略中的IP安全策略对IP进行了限制,表现形式如下:当文件共享服务已经启动后,命令行界面中使用netstat -ano | findstr 445命令可以查看该端口已经监听在0.0.0.0(表示该机器的所有网卡)上,此时可以使用telnet 127.0.0.1 445测试可以通,但是telnet 内网地址 445就会被拒绝,可想而知如果本机IP都拒绝的话,其他机器肯定无法进行访问,此时解决办法如下:
1、Win + R打开运行工具输入gpedit.msc打开本地策略组;
2、依次打开计算机设置-->Windows设置-->安全设置→IP安全策略,在本地计算机;
3、打开相应策略将IP安全规则删除应用后确认退出进行测试。

  • 确保共享文件需要使用的服务处于开启状态。

使用如下方法确认共享文件所需服务都处于开启状态:
1、Win + R打开运行工具输入services.msc打开服务列表;
2、依次确认以下服务处于运行状态:UPnP Device Host、TCP/IP NetBIOS Helper、SSDP Discovery、Server;
3、打开控制面板→网络和 Internet-->网络和共享中心-->高级共享,启用网络发现、文件和打印机共享。

posted @ 2019-10-12 13:42  Federico  阅读(6585)  评论(0编辑  收藏  举报